Password entry (on day of race) Practise: 19:30 (45 mins) Qual: 20:15 (15 mins) Race: 20:30 30 minutes Cars allowed: Mustang 302R https://www.racedepartment.com/downloads/1970s-performance-mustangs.19574/updatesTrack: Riverside (Long) Track: Riverside[/quote] Live Timing: stracker.simracing.org.uk:50041/lapstatTime of Day Setting: 16:00 Weather: Mid-clear Start: Standing Tyre wear: Normal Fuel consumption: Normal Pit-stops: Not required Server track settings: SESSION_START=100 RANDOMNESS=0 LAP_GAIN=0 SESSION_TRANSFER=N/a Damage: 80% Password: see abovePLP App - Not used in this series. Cutting will be monitored on replay and penalties issued for excessive cutting. Notes: (1) Please make sure you are fully aware of the UKGTR Rules
